Calhoun to miss third game with spinal issue

 

Published: February 8, 2012

STORRS, Conn. (AP) — Connecticut men's basketball coach Jim Calhoun says he's feeling better, but will miss his third straight game Saturday at Syracuse with spinal stenosis.

The Hall of Fame coach, in a news release Wednesday, says he will be meeting with specialists over the next few days to determine the best course of treatment for his condition.
